About Cauliflower and pea curry

Cauliflower and Pea Curry is a vibrant vegetarian dish rooted in Indian cuisine, celebrated for its bold flavors and nutrient-rich ingredients. This curry typically features tender cauliflower florets and sweet green peas simmered in a spiced tomato-based sauce infused with aromatic garlic, ginger, cumin, turmeric, and garam masala. Often cooked with a splash of coconut milk or yogurt, it achieves a creamy texture while remaining light and wholesome. Cauliflower is low in calories and rich in fiber, antioxidants, and vitamins, while peas provide protein, fiber, and essential nutrients like vitamin K and folate. Cooked with minimal oil and served with whole-grain rice or flatbread, it offers a balanced meal that supports digestion and heart health. However, creamy additives or excess oil may increase calorie content, so mindful preparation ensures a healthy, flavorful option for everyday dining.
